Aneet Padda reveals Alia Bhatt gushed over 'Saiyaara' for 10 minutes

Aneet Padda has been the quintessential girl in the conversations, after the dazzling performance alongside Ahaan Panday in their hit film ‘Saiyaara.’ Flipping the entire box office around, the duo caught lightning in a bottle with the romantic drama, dominating the industry. While fans expressed their love on social media, one of the gracious artists, Alia Bhatt, couldn’t help but gush over the 22-year-old actress as well.

Aneet Padda recalls Alia Bhatt gushing for ‘Saiyaara’

Padda recalled a fangirl moment with her idol, Alia Bhatt, when the renowned actress praised the former’s performance in the recent hit. While the ‘Gully Boy’ star praised ‘Saiyaara’ on social media, Aneet, during her Cosmopolitan interview, revealed that Alia gushed about the film for 10 minutes on a call. Narrating why the parasocial relationship was so important for her, Padda revealed how she used to practice Bhatt’s monologues. Aneet said, “I would talk to myself in the bathroom mirror (when I was young) and practise all of Bhatt’s monologues, thinking, ‘How can I do it?’ and then, ‘How can I do it my way?’”

Aneet Padda’s way to acting

Elsewhere in the interview, Padda mentioned how she used to practice acting with her friends. For someone who achieved new heights in cinema, she was initially underconfident due to a lack of support from her friends and especially her father. Overcoming the obstacles, the 22-year-old finally decided to act and hired friends to practice lines with her. However, she gently let them go because the ‘chemistry was a bit off,’ and she later realised that she had the best compatibility with – herself. As she began researching on search engines, Padda found some shady websites, “scams, basically,” along the way.
